1. Search a PROMO CODE
2. Go to Official Hotel Site
3. Book Direct




Show 4 photos
Saranda Alb
14 Thevista, London, United Kingdom
Show map
Nearby Hotels

Ilir
14 The Vista Eltham,LondonSelect check-in date
Sun | Mon | Tue | Wed | Thu | Fri | Sat |
---|---|---|---|---|---|---|
Compare other sites
Show 4 photos
Show map
Ilir
14 The Vista Eltham,London